Fig. 3From: Full genome characterization of porcine circovirus type 3 isolates reveals the existence of two distinct groups of virus strainsPhylogenetic analysis of PCV3 based on ORF2 and identification of group specific amino acid motifs. a Phylogenetic tree based on ORF2 of 24 German PCV3 strains (●) and 30 PCV3 reference strains (GenBank accession number, country and year of collection; more details are listed in Table A1). The tree was constructed using the neighbor joining method (p-distance model; 1000 bootstraps; only bootstrap values above 50 are shown). The scale bar indicates nucleotide substitutions per site. b Amino acid alignments of the putative ORFs 1, 2 and 3 were used to identify group specific motifsBack to article page
